public static final class StringArraySerializer extends Serializer<String[]> {
private final StringSerializer stringSerializer;

public StringArraySerializer(Fury fury) {
super(fury, String[].class);
stringSerializer = new StringSerializer(fury);
}

@Override
public short getCrossLanguageTypeId() {
return (short) -Type.FURY_STRING_ARRAY.getId();
}

@Override
public void write(MemoryBuffer buffer, String[] value) {
int len = value.length;
buffer.writeInt(len);
for (String elem : value) {
// TODO reference support
if (elem != null) {
buffer.writeByte(Fury.REF_VALUE_FLAG);
stringSerializer.writeJavaString(buffer, elem);
} else {
buffer.writeByte(Fury.NULL_FLAG);
}
}
}

@Override
public String[] read(MemoryBuffer buffer) {
int numElements = buffer.readInt();
String[] value = new String[numElements];
fury.getReferenceResolver().reference(value);
for (int i = 0; i < numElements; i++) {
if (buffer.readByte() == Fury.REF_VALUE_FLAG) {
value[i] = stringSerializer.readJavaString(buffer);
} else {
value[i] = null;
}
}
return value;
}

@Override
public void crossLanguageWrite(MemoryBuffer buffer, String[] value) {
int len = value.length;
buffer.writeInt(len);
for (String elem : value) {
if (elem != null) {
buffer.writeByte(Fury.REF_VALUE_FLAG);
stringSerializer.writeUTF8String(buffer, elem);
} else {
buffer.writeByte(Fury.NULL_FLAG);
}
}
}

@Override
public String[] crossLanguageRead(MemoryBuffer buffer) {
int numElements = buffer.readInt();
String[] value = new String[numElements];
for (int i = 0; i < numElements; i++) {
if (buffer.readByte() == Fury.REF_VALUE_FLAG) {
value[i] = stringSerializer.readUTF8String(buffer);
} else {
value[i] = null;
}
}
return value;
}
}
